Intel Core i5-8500B or Intel Pentium G3240 - which processor is faster? In this comparison we look at the differences and analyze which of these two CPUs is better. We compare the technical data and benchmark results.

The Intel Core i5-8500B has 6 cores with 6 threads and clocks with a maximum frequency of 4.10 GHz. Up to 64 GB of memory is supported in 2 memory channels. The Intel Core i5-8500B was released in Q1/2018.

The Intel Pentium G3240 has 2 cores with 2 threads and clocks with a maximum frequency of 3.10 GHz. The CPU supports up to 32 GB of memory in 2 memory channels. The Intel Pentium G3240 was released in Q2/2014.

CPU Cores and Base Frequency

The Intel Core i5-8500B is a 6 core processor with a clock frequency of 3.00 GHz (4.10 GHz). The Intel Pentium G3240 has 2 CPU cores with a clock frequency of 3.10 GHz.

Memory & PCIe

The Intel Core i5-8500B supports a maximum of 64 GB of memory in 2 memory channels. The Intel Pentium G3240 can connect up to 32 GB of memory in 2 memory channels.

Thermal Management

The TDP (Thermal Design Power) of a processor specifies the required cooling solution. The Intel Core i5-8500B has a TDP of 65 W, that of the Intel Pentium G3240 is 54 W.
